A 31-year-old woman is brought to the emergency department for a severe throbbing headache, nausea, and photophobia for 3 hours. She has severe occipital pain and chest tightness. Prior to onset of symptoms, she had attended a networking event where she had red wine and, shortly after, a snack consisting of salami and some dried fruits. The patient has recurrent migraine headaches and depression, for which she takes medication daily. She is mildly distressed, diaphoretic, and her face is flushed. Her temperature is 37.0°C (98.6 F), pulse is 90/min, respirations are 20/min, and blood pressure is 195/130 mmHg. She is alert and oriented. Deep-tendon reflexes are 2+ bilaterally. This patient's symptoms are most likely caused by a side effect of which of the following medications?

A) Amitriptyline

B) Ibuprofen

C) Verapamil

D) Sumatriptan

E) Phenelzine

Phenelzine, a monoamine oxidase inhibitor (MAOI), is typically reserved for treatment-resistant or atypical major depressive disorder given its severe side effect profile and numerous drug interactions. Monoamine oxidase breaks down excess tyramine in the body. Since MAOIs block this enzyme, the consumption of tyramine-rich foods (e.g., red wine, certain nuts, aged cheeses or meats, dried fruits) leads to an accumulation of tyramine. This, in turn, leads to a release of norepinephrine that can provoke a hypertensive crisis, as seen in this patient.

What are the 5 stages of "Patient Readiness to Change"

Pre-Contemplation: Henry would not be ready to change but you can discuss benefits of physical activity

Contemplation: Henry may be receptive to receiving basic guidance on becoming more physically active. 

Preparation: You can write physical activity perscription for Henry or refer to exercise professionals

Action: Discuss relapse prevention strategies - plan for challenges. Applaud efforts that Henry has made

Maintenance: Encourage Henry to spend time with people with similar healthy behaviours. Applaud efforts.

A 24-year-old man comes to the physician because of back pain after being severely sunburned on his upper back 3 days ago. He now experiences pain in the affected area when applying cream or putting on a shirt. Physical examination of the upper back shows erythema of the skin and some mild blistering. Sensitization of which of the following structures would best explain this patient's symptoms?

A) Glycinergic receptors of thalamic neurons

B) Nociceptors of dorsal root

C) Ruffini corpuscles of sensory neurons

D) Glutaminergic receptors of ventral horn neurons


E) Opioid synapses of interneurons

B) The nociceptors of the dorsal root are involved in the pathophysiology of dysfunctional perceptions of pain, such as allodynia. Although incompletely understood, allodynia is thought to result from both peripheral and central sensitization. After an injury (e.g., sunburn), cytokines, nerve growth factors, and other chemical mediators are released in the injured area, leading to a constant, increased input to the nociceptors. This causes an up-regulation of the ion channels in the nociceptors, making them more sensitive to chemical mediators and lowering the threshold to stimulus, consequently causing more action potentials to form. This phenomenon is known as peripheral sensitization. The constant increased peripheral output is likely a significant driver to the sensitization of central nociceptive neurons, which likely contributes to the persistence of allodynia long after the initial injury (e.g., in postherpetic neuralgia).

What are 5 categories that are tested in Waddell's Score.


Tenderness: Superficial, and diffuse tenderness and/or non-anatomical tenderness

Simulation: tests based on movements which produce pain, without actually causing that movement i.e.) Axial loading and pain on simulated rotation

Distraction: Positive tests are rechecked when the patient's attention is distracted, such as a straight leg raise test

Regional Disturbance: Regional weakness or sensory changes which deviate from accepted neuroanatomy 

Overreaction: Subjective signs regarding the patients demeanour and reaction to testing

Explain the difference between Factitious Disorder and Malingering.


Bonus: If you say what I'm thinking you'll get an extra 100 points. Has to do with the DSM-V

Factitious Disorder (aka Munchausen's): Patient is consciously producing symptoms but NOT for secondary gain. Like's to assume the sick role or sick role by proxy (be aware of child abuse)

Malingering: Patient fabricates symptoms of physical disorders for secondary gain or external reward

What I was thinking: Malingering is NOT a mental illness or a psychiatric pathology. Not in the DSM-V

A 61-year-old woman with a history of stage IV pancreatic cancer comes to the emergency department with insomnia due to intractable midepigastric pain. The pain had been constant for months but has worsened over the past few weeks despite the fact that she is already taking hydrocodone 10 mg and ibuprofen 400 mg. She has a past medical history of chronic pain and major depressive disorder. In the past month, she has been taking her pain medications with increasing frequency, going from twice a day to four times a day. Her other medications include venlafaxine and eszopiclone. She describes her mood as low, but states she does not have any suicidal thoughts. She appears fatigued and slightly cachectic. Her temperature is 36°C (96.8°F), pulse is 100/min, and blood pressure is 128/65 mm Hg. Physical examination shows a mass in the midepigastric region. Which of the following is the most appropriate next step in management?

A) Discontinue hydrocodone and ibuprofen, and start IV ketorolac

B) Switch from hydrocodone to hydromorphone

C) Administer regional block of the celiac plexus using lidocaine

D) Switch from eszopiclone to zolpidem

E) Allow the patient to take hydrocodone and ibuprofen up to every four hours
B) Switch from hydrocodone to hydromorphone

This patient's current pain medications (hydrocodone and ibuprofen) are not providing her with enough pain relief. Therefore, she needs to be switched to a stronger medication (e.g., hydromorphone) according to the WHO analgesic ladder. When converting between opioids, patients will likely have less tolerance to a new opioid than to their previous opioid (i.e., incomplete cross-tolerance), therefore, it should be given at a 25–50% lower dose, then adjusted according to the patient's pain score. Additionally, this patient should continue taking ibuprofen, as nonopioid analgesics should be used in each step of the ladder for effective and balanced pain relief.

Name 6 of the 11 symptoms that are assessed in the Clinical Opiate Withdrawal Scale (COWS) 

Resting Pulse Rate, Sweating, Restlessness, Pupil Size, Bone or Joint Ache, Runny Nose or tearing, GI Upset, Tremor, Yawning, Anxiety or Irritability, Gooseflesh Skin/Goosebumps

A 73-year-old man is brought to the emergency department 30 minutes after the sudden onset of right-sided body weakness. His wife reports that he does not seem to understand simple questions. He has type 2 diabetes mellitus and has smoked 1 pack of cigarettes daily for 45 years. The patient speaks fluently, but he answers questions with nonsensical phrases and cannot repeat single words. What type of aphasia is the most likely diagnosis?


Wernicke aphasia is caused by lesions in the superior temporal gyrus of the dominant (usually left) hemisphere, usually along the left MCA distribution. Patients with Wernicke aphasia typically present with impaired language comprehension and repetition; although they can speak fluently, they produce nonsensical phrases. Furthermore, these patients lack awareness of their impairment, as is the case here. In addition to Wernicke aphasia, signs of an MCA stroke include gaze deviation towards the side of the infarction and contralateral homonymous hemianopia without macular sparing.

Explain the WHO Analgesic Ladder for Cancer Pain Relief. Name/explain the 3 steps.

1. Mild Pain 1-3, (non-opioid +/- adjuvant)

2. Moderate Pain 4-6, Opioid for mild to moderate pain (+/- non-opioid, +/- adjuvant)

3. Severe Pain 7-10, Opioid for moderate to severe pain (+/- non-opioid, +/- adjuvant)
